/**
 * Censors detected Personally Identifiable Information (PII) in a string using a hybrid approach.
 *
 * This function combines Named Entity Recognition (NER) for contextual PII (names, orgs, locations)
 * with Regular Expressions (Regex) for structured PII (SSN, credit cards, emails, phones, etc.).
 *
 * @param {string} input The string to censor.
 * @returns {Promise<string>} A promise that resolves to the censored string.
 */
export function censorPII(input: string): Promise<string>;

/**
 * Singleton class to manage the Named Entity Recognition (NER) pipeline from transformers.js.
 * Ensures that the NER model is loaded only once.
 */
export class NerPipelineSingleton {
    static task: string;
    static model: string;
    static instance: null;
    /**
     * Retrieves the singleton instance of the NER pipeline.
     * @param {function} [progress_callback=null] - Optional callback function for progress updates during model loading.
     * @returns {Promise<object>} A promise that resolves to the NER pipeline instance.
     */
    static getInstance(progress_callback?: Function): Promise<object>;
}
